(2)Jacob van Ruisdael (1628/29-82) Salomon's nephew. Born in Haarlem, he was probably taught by his father Isaac, a frame maker and art dealer, and joined the city's painters' guild in 1648. … *Some of the terminology that mentions "Ruisdael, J. van" is listed below.
